A-A+
jquery 实现删除文章提示是否删除
我们在做后台数据管理时删除数据都会有一个提示确认删除框,这个是友好提示并且也是防止用户不小心点击了删除按钮了,下面一起来看一个jquery 实现删除文章提示是否删除例子.
为了更好的用户体验,当用户在删除文章的时候给出一个提醒的功能,提示他是否删除这篇文章。具体实现代码如下:
html代码:
- <a link="{:U('Athlete/del/',array('uid'=>$vo['id']))}" href="javascript:void(0)" name="{$vo.name}" class="del">删除 </a>
jquery代码:
- <script type="text/javascript">
- $(function(){
- $(".del").click(function(){
- var delLink=$(this).attr("link");
- confirm('你真的打算删除【<b>'+$(this).attr("name")+'</b>】吗?','温馨提示',function(action){
- if(action == 'ok'){
- top.window.location.href=delLink;
- }
- });
- return false;
- });
- });
- </script>
其实就是用到confirm函数,这个与jquery没有多大的判断了,我也可以有更简单的办法如下
第一种:最简单的JS删除确认,直接写在链接里:
- <a href=""javascript:if(confirm("确认要删除该内容?"))location="del.asp?&areyou=删除&id=1"">删除</a>
第二种:定义一个函数,优点是可重复调用:
- <script language="javascript">
- function del_sure(){
- var gnl=confirm("确定要删除?");
- if (gnl==true){
- return true;
- }else{
- return false;
- }
- }
- </script>
调用方法:
- <a href="del.asp?id=<%=rs("id")%>" onclick="javascript:del_sure()">删除</a>